Output e357836979682cdd7ee5731b85baea986bd55400f4ca30fe6b51522fd762da02:189

value
25376
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 555cd8c185ecde2b55f5176f8f52a76c311dd86d OP_EQUALVERIFY OP_CHECKSIG
address
18nMfQeAmMEggQo17WtSo3BysrwsD7wKNa
transaction
e357836979682cdd7ee5731b85baea986bd55400f4ca30fe6b51522fd762da02
spent
true